React native 渲染场景仅显示最后一个组件

React native 渲染场景仅显示最后一个组件,react-native,react-router,react-redux,tabnavigator,React Native,React Router,React Redux,Tabnavigator,我在学习过程中遇到了一个奇怪的bug,它只在react native中显示渲染场景中的最后一个组件,我不知道搜索google会出现什么类型的问题。请帮助我,并引导我到一些主题,如果已经有 render() { return ( <Provider store={store}> <Navigator initialRoute={{ name: 'mainScreen' }} configureScene={(route

我在学习过程中遇到了一个奇怪的bug,它只在react native中显示渲染场景中的最后一个组件,我不知道搜索google会出现什么类型的问题。请帮助我,并引导我到一些主题,如果已经有

render() {
return (

  <Provider store={store}>

     <Navigator
      initialRoute={{ name: 'mainScreen' }}          
      configureScene={(route, routeStack) => Navigator.SceneConfigs.FloatFromBottom}          
      renderScene={RouteMapper}
    />



  </Provider>, <BottomBar />
 );
}
该问题仅在应用程序中显示,主屏幕newfeed未显示

添加了renderscene代码部分。
const RouteMapper=(路由、导航器)=>{
如果(route.name=='mainScreen'){
返回(
);
} 
};

我可以看一下你的渲染场景吗?@Codesingh当然可以,在que中添加。
export const BottomBar= TabNavigator({
Home: {
    screen: Home,
  },
},
Settings: {
    screen: Settings,
  },
 },
});
const RouteMapper = (route, navigator) => {
 if (route.name === 'mainScreen') {
return (
  <main navigator={navigator} />
);
} 
};